25.1.40 • Published 3 days ago

@syncfusion/ej2-angular-navigations v25.1.40

Weekly downloads
6,760
License
SEE LICENSE IN li...
Repository
github
Last release
3 days ago

Angular Navigation Components

What's Included in the Angular Navigation Package

The Angular Navigation package includes the following list of components.

Angular Accordion

The Angular Accordion component is a container-based control with vertically collapsible panels (vertical accordion) and stacked headers that expand or collapse one or more panels at a time within the available space.

Key features

  • Rendering - Can be rendered based on the items collection and HTML elements.
  • Expand mode - Supports to define single or multiple expand mode for Accordion panels.
  • RTL Support - Supports right-to-left alignment.
  • Accessibility - Provides built-in compliance with the WAI-ARIA specifications and it is achieved through attributes. By default, it allows to interact with Accordion by using keyboard shortcuts.

Angular AppBar

The Angular AppBar component displays information and actions related to the current application screen. It is used to show branding, screen titles, navigation, and actions.

Key features

  • Modes - Regular, Prominent, and Dense modes that define the AppBar height.
  • Content arrangement - Spacer and separator options can be used to align the content based on the UI requirement with minimal effort.
  • Color - Primary, Light, Dark, and Inherit options to customize the AppBar color.
  • Position - AppBars can be placed at the top or bottom of the screen. It can also be sticky.

Angular Breadcrumb

The Angular Breadcrumb component is a graphical user interface that serves as a navigation header for your web application or site. It helps to identify or highlight the current location within the hierarchical structure of a website. It has several built-in features such as templates, icons, binding to location, overflow mode, and UI customizations.

Key features

  • Icons - Icons can be specified in Breadcrumb items.
  • Template - Supports template for item and separator.
  • Bind to location - Supports items to be rendered based on the URL or current location.
  • Overflow mode - Used to limit the number of breadcrumb items to be displayed.
  • Accessibility - Provided with built-in accessibility support that helps to access all the Breadcrumb component features through the keyboard, screen readers, or other assistive technology devices.

Angular Carousel

The Angular Carousel component allows users to display images with content, links, etc., like a slide show. Typical uses of carousels include scrolling news headlines, featured articles on home pages, and image galleries.

Key features

  • Rendering - The Carousel component can be rendered based on the items collection and data binding.
  • Animation - Supports animation effects for moving previous/next item of Carousel.
  • Template support - The Carousel component items and buttons can also be rendered with custom templates.
  • Keyboard support - By default, the Carousel allows interaction with commands by using keyboard shortcuts.
  • Accessibility - The Carousel provides built-in compliance with the WAI-ARIA specifications and it is achieved through attributes.

Angular ContextMenu

The Angular ContextMenu component is a graphical user interface control that appears when the user right-clicks or performs a touch and hold action.

Key features

  • Separator - Supports menu items grouping by using the Separator.
  • Icons and Navigations - Supports items to have Icons and Navigation URL's.
  • Template and Multilevel nesting - Supports template and multilevel nesting in ContextMenu.
  • Accessibility - Provided with built-in accessibility support that helps to access all the ContextMenu component features through the keyboard, screen readers, or other assistive technology devices.

Angular Sidebar

The Angular Sidebar component is an expandable and collapsible component that typically acts as a side container to place primary or secondary content alongside the main content.

Key features

  • Target - The sidebar can be initialized in any HTML element other than the body element.
  • Types - Provides complete control over the appearance of the sidebar component. The different types of the sidebar control give flexibility to view or hide the content (primary/secondary) over/above the main content by pushing, sliding, or overlaying it.
  • Left or right positions - The sidebar control can be positioned to the left or right side of the main content area. This option allows placement of two sidebars in a page, at the left and right, to show primary content and secondary content, simultaneously.
  • Docking - Docking lets the sidebar occupy a small vertical area in a page always and typically contains shortened view of navigation options.
  • Auto close - Auto closing the sidebar control’s content allows the main content area to be more readable based on screen resolution.

Angular Tab

The Angular Tab component is a simple user interface (tabs UI) for organizing related content and occupying a compact space. The tabs are aligned horizontally, and each tab is associated with its header.

Key features

  • Rendering - Can be rendered based on the items collection and HTML elements.
  • Adaptive - Supports responsive rendering with scrollable Tabs and popup menu.
  • Customization - Provides customization support for header with icons and orientation.
  • Animation - Supports animation effects for moving previous/next contents of Tab.
  • Accessibility - Provides built-in compliance with the WAI-ARIA specifications and it is achieved through attributes. By default, it allows to interact with Tab headers by using keyboard shortcuts.

Angular Toolbar

The Angular Toolbar component is a feature-rich control that provides an interface for selecting a command from a collection of commands.

Key features

  • Scrollable - Scrollable display mode displays Toolbar commands in a single line with horizontal scrolling enabled when the commands overflow available space.
  • Popup - Popup display mode displays commands in the popup when the commands overflow available space.
  • Template support - The Toolbar component can also be rendered based on the given HTML element aside from item based collection rendering.
  • Keyboard support - By default, the Toolbar allows interaction with commands by using keyboard shortcuts.
  • RTL Support - The Toolbar supports right-to-left alignment.
  • Accessibility - The Toolbar provides built-in compliance with the WAI-ARIA specifications and it is achieved through attributes.

Angular TreeView

The Angular TreeView component is a graphical user interface control that to represents hierarchical data in a tree structure.

Key features

  • Data binding - Binds the TreeView component with an array of JavaScript objects or DataManager.
  • CheckBox - Allows you to select more than one node in TreeView without affecting the UI appearance.
  • Drag and drop - Allows you to drag and drop any node in TreeView.
  • Multi selection - Allows you to select more than one node in TreeView.
  • Node editing - Allows you to change the text of a node in TreeView.
  • Sorting - Allows display of the TreeView nodes in an ascending or a descending order.
  • Template - Allows you to customize the nodes in TreeView.
  • Accessibility - Provides built-in accessibility support that helps to access all the TreeView component features through the keyboard, on-screen readers, or other assistive technology devices.

Angular Menu

The Angular Menu component is a graphical user interface control that serves as a navigation header for your web application or site. It supports data binding, templates, icons, multilevel nesting, and horizontal and vertical menus.

Key features

  • Rendering - Supports to render based on the items collection (array of JavaScript objects) and HTML elements.
  • Separator - Supports menu items grouping by using the Separator.
  • Icons and Navigations - Supports items to have Icons and Navigation URL's.
  • Template and Multilevel nesting - Supports template and multilevel nesting in Menu.
  • Hamburger Menu - Supports Hamburger Menu that provides an adaptive view.
  • Accessibility - Provided with built-in accessibility support that helps to access all the Menu component features through the keyboard, screen readers, or other assistive technology devices.

Angular Stepper

The Angular Stepper component enables users to navigate through a series of steps or stages in a process within a web application. Stepper displays a list of steps with the current step highlighted, allowing users to move between steps. It includes several built-in features, such as different step types, orientation, linear flow, label positions, and template customization.

Key features

  • Step Types - Display steps with indicators and labels, only indicators, or only labels.
  • Orientation - A layout to display steps in a horizontal or vertical orientation.
  • Linear Flow - Enable a step-by-step progression, completing one step before moving on to the next.
  • Label Positioning - Show the label at the top, bottom, left, or right.
  • Tooltip - Show additional information when users hover over a step, such as a label or customized text.
  • Templates - Customize the default appearance and content of each step using templates.

Setup

To install navigations and its dependent packages, use the following command.

npm install @syncfusion/ej2-angular-navigations

Supported frameworks

Navigation components are also offered in following list of frameworks.

     JavaScript           React             Vue           ASP.NET Core    ASP.NET MVC  

Showcase samples

Support

Product support is available through following mediums.

Changelog

Check the changelog here. Get minor improvements and bug fixes every week to stay up to date with frequent updates.

License and copyright

This is a commercial product and requires a paid license for possession or use. Syncfusion’s licensed software, including this component, is subject to the terms and conditions of Syncfusion's EULA. To acquire a license for 80+ Angular UI components, you can purchase or start a free 30-day trial.

A free community license is also available for companies and individuals whose organizations have less than $1 million USD in annual gross revenue and five or fewer developers.

See LICENSE FILE for more info.

© Copyright 2024 Syncfusion, Inc. All Rights Reserved. The Syncfusion Essential Studio license and copyright applies to this distribution.

25.1.40-ngcc

3 days ago

25.1.40

3 days ago

25.1.39-ngcc

10 days ago

25.1.39

10 days ago

25.1.38-ngcc

17 days ago

25.1.38

17 days ago

25.1.37-ngcc

24 days ago

25.1.37

24 days ago

25.1.35-ngcc

1 month ago

25.1.35

1 month ago

24.2.8

2 months ago

24.2.8-ngcc

2 months ago

24.2.4-ngcc

2 months ago

24.2.4

2 months ago

24.2.3

3 months ago

24.2.3-ngcc

3 months ago

24.1.46

3 months ago

24.1.46-ngcc

3 months ago

24.1.41

4 months ago

24.1.41-ngcc

4 months ago

19.3.54-13828

5 months ago

23.2.5-ngcc

5 months ago

23.2.7-ngcc

5 months ago

23.2.5

5 months ago

23.2.7

5 months ago

23.1.44-ngcc

5 months ago

22.2.7-ngcc

9 months ago

22.2.11-ngcc

8 months ago

22.2.8-ngcc

8 months ago

22.1.38-ngcc

9 months ago

23.1.36-ngcc

7 months ago

23.1.43-ngcc

6 months ago

23.1.41-ngcc

6 months ago

22.2.8

8 months ago

22.2.7

9 months ago

22.2.5

9 months ago

22.1.38

9 months ago

22.1.39

9 months ago

22.2.11

8 months ago

23.2.4

5 months ago

23.1.40

6 months ago

23.1.41

6 months ago

23.1.44

5 months ago

23.1.43

6 months ago

23.1.39-ngcc

7 months ago

22.2.5-ngcc

9 months ago

23.1.36

7 months ago

23.1.39

7 months ago

23.2.4-ngcc

5 months ago

23.1.40-ngcc

6 months ago

22.1.39-ngcc

9 months ago

22.1.36-ngcc

10 months ago

22.1.36

10 months ago

21.1.36-ngcc

10 months ago

21.1.36

10 months ago

21.1.42

10 months ago

22.1.35

10 months ago

22.1.34-ngcc

10 months ago

21.2.9

11 months ago

22.1.34

10 months ago

21.2.9-ngcc

11 months ago

21.2.8

11 months ago

21.2.4

12 months ago

21.2.3

12 months ago

21.2.6

11 months ago

21.2.5

11 months ago

21.2.3-ngcc

12 months ago

21.2.5-ngcc

11 months ago

21.2.8-ngcc

11 months ago

21.2.6-ngcc

11 months ago

21.2.4-ngcc

12 months ago

16.4.52-46585

1 year ago

20.4.53

1 year ago

21.1.38-ngcc

1 year ago

20.4.53-ngcc

1 year ago

21.1.35

1 year ago

21.1.39

1 year ago

21.1.38

1 year ago

21.1.37

1 year ago

21.1.35-ngcc

1 year ago

21.1.37-ngcc

1 year ago

21.1.39-ngcc

1 year ago

20.4.52

1 year ago

20.4.52-ngcc

1 year ago

20.4.51

1 year ago

20.4.51-ngcc

1 year ago

20.4.49

1 year ago

20.4.48

1 year ago

20.4.49-ngcc

1 year ago

20.4.48-ngcc

1 year ago

20.4.38-ngcc

1 year ago

20.4.44-ngcc

1 year ago

20.4.42-ngcc

1 year ago

20.4.44

1 year ago

20.4.43

1 year ago

20.4.42

1 year ago

20.4.40

1 year ago

20.3.60-ngcc

1 year ago

20.4.38

1 year ago

20.3.60

1 year ago

20.4.43-ngcc

1 year ago

20.4.40-ngcc

1 year ago

20.3.48-ngcc

2 years ago

20.3.57-ngcc

1 year ago

20.3.58-ngcc

1 year ago

20.3.50-ngcc

2 years ago

20.3.58

1 year ago

20.3.57

1 year ago

20.3.56

1 year ago

20.3.52

1 year ago

20.3.50

2 years ago

20.3.49

2 years ago

20.3.48

2 years ago

20.3.56-ngcc

1 year ago

20.3.49-ngcc

2 years ago

20.3.52-ngcc

1 year ago

20.2.49-ngcc

2 years ago

20.2.50

2 years ago

20.2.46-ngcc

2 years ago

20.2.48-ngcc

2 years ago

20.2.50-ngcc

2 years ago

20.3.47-ngcc

2 years ago

20.3.47

2 years ago

20.2.46

2 years ago

20.2.48

2 years ago

20.2.49

2 years ago

20.2.45-ngcc

2 years ago

20.2.45

2 years ago

20.2.43-ngcc

2 years ago

20.2.36-ngcc

2 years ago

20.2.37-ngcc

2 years ago

20.2.38-ngcc

2 years ago

20.2.44-ngcc

2 years ago

20.1.60

2 years ago

20.1.61

2 years ago

20.2.36

2 years ago

20.2.38

2 years ago

20.2.39

2 years ago

20.2.39-ngcc

2 years ago

20.2.43

2 years ago

20.2.44

2 years ago

20.1.55

2 years ago

20.1.56

2 years ago

20.1.57

2 years ago

20.1.58

2 years ago

20.1.47

2 years ago

20.1.48

2 years ago

20.1.51

2 years ago

19.4.56

2 years ago

19.4.55

2 years ago

19.4.41

2 years ago

19.4.47

2 years ago

19.4.48

2 years ago

19.4.50

2 years ago

19.4.52

2 years ago

19.4.53

2 years ago

19.3.53

2 years ago

19.3.56

2 years ago

19.3.57

2 years ago

19.3.54

2 years ago

19.4.38

2 years ago

19.4.40

2 years ago

19.3.45

3 years ago

19.3.46

3 years ago

19.3.44

3 years ago

19.3.43

3 years ago

19.2.62

3 years ago

19.2.60

3 years ago

19.2.59

3 years ago

19.2.56

3 years ago

19.2.55

3 years ago

19.2.51

3 years ago

19.2.48

3 years ago

19.2.46

3 years ago

19.2.44

3 years ago

19.1.69

3 years ago

19.1.67

3 years ago

19.1.66

3 years ago

19.1.63

3 years ago

19.1.59

3 years ago

19.1.58

3 years ago

19.1.57

3 years ago

19.1.54

3 years ago

18.4.47

3 years ago

18.4.44

3 years ago

18.4.42

3 years ago

18.4.41

3 years ago

18.4.39

3 years ago

18.4.35

3 years ago

18.4.34

3 years ago

18.4.33

3 years ago

18.4.31

3 years ago

18.4.30

3 years ago

18.3.53

3 years ago

18.3.51

3 years ago

18.3.50

3 years ago

18.3.47

3 years ago

18.3.44

3 years ago

18.3.42

3 years ago

18.3.40

4 years ago

18.3.35

4 years ago

18.2.58

4 years ago

18.2.57

4 years ago

18.2.55

4 years ago

18.2.54

4 years ago

18.2.47

4 years ago

18.2.46

4 years ago

18.2.44

4 years ago

18.1.57

4 years ago

18.1.55

4 years ago

18.1.54

4 years ago

18.1.52

4 years ago

18.1.46

4 years ago

18.1.45

4 years ago

18.1.43

4 years ago

18.1.42

4 years ago

18.1.36-beta

4 years ago

17.4.55

4 years ago

17.4.51

4 years ago

17.4.50

4 years ago

17.4.49

4 years ago

17.4.47

4 years ago

17.4.46

4 years ago

17.4.44

4 years ago

17.4.43

4 years ago

17.4.42

4 years ago

17.4.41

4 years ago

17.4.39

4 years ago

17.3.34

4 years ago

17.3.27

4 years ago

17.3.26

4 years ago

17.3.21

4 years ago

17.3.20

4 years ago

17.3.19

4 years ago

17.3.17

5 years ago

17.3.16

5 years ago

17.3.14

5 years ago

17.3.9-beta

5 years ago

17.2.49

5 years ago

17.2.48-beta

5 years ago

17.2.29-beta

5 years ago

17.2.47

5 years ago

17.2.46

5 years ago

17.2.41

5 years ago

17.2.40

5 years ago

17.2.39

5 years ago

17.2.36

5 years ago

17.2.34

5 years ago

17.2.28-beta

5 years ago

17.1.49

5 years ago

17.1.48

5 years ago

17.1.47

5 years ago

17.1.43

5 years ago

17.1.42

5 years ago

17.1.41

5 years ago

17.1.40

5 years ago

17.1.39

5 years ago

17.1.38

5 years ago

17.1.32-beta

5 years ago

16.4.54

5 years ago

16.4.53

5 years ago

16.4.52

5 years ago

17.1.1-beta

5 years ago

16.4.47

5 years ago

16.4.45

5 years ago

16.4.44

5 years ago

16.4.42

5 years ago

16.4.40-beta

5 years ago

16.3.34

5 years ago

16.3.33

5 years ago

16.3.30

5 years ago

16.3.29

5 years ago

16.3.27

5 years ago

16.3.25

6 years ago

16.3.24

6 years ago

16.3.23

6 years ago

16.3.21

6 years ago

16.3.18

6 years ago

16.3.17

6 years ago